P0780 — Shift Error

The fault code P0780 indicates a problem within the vehicle’s transmission control system, specifically related to an inconsistent or faulty shift error. This code is set when the Transmission Control Module (TCM) detects abnormal signals or issues during gear shifting processes. Please note that the exact label or terminology used by different vehicle manufacturers (OEMs) may vary slightly.

Fast Facts:

  • System affected: Transmission Control System
  • Severity: Moderate to High (depends on symptoms and driving conditions)
  • Main symptoms: Gear shifting issues, warning lights, transmission hesitation
  • Driveability: Limited — vehicle may still operate but with compromised transmission performance

Manufacturer variations for trouble code P0780

Different vehicle manufacturers may assign varied labels or slight variations to the P0780 trouble code. These labels typically indicate the same underlying problem but appear differently in manufacturer-specific diagnostic tools or documentation. Here are some known variations:

  • Ford: P0780 — Shift Control Error
  • GM / General Motors: P0780 — Transmission Control Shift Error
  • Volkswagen: 18078 — Shift Module Malfunction
  • BMW: 2F32 — Gearbox Shift Error (may have different code in OBD-II)
  • Hyundai/Kia: P0780 — Transmission Shift Error

What does trouble code P0780 mean?

In simple terms, P0780 indicates that the vehicle’s transmission control system has detected an inconsistency or fault during gear shifting. The ECU (Engine Control Unit), often combined with the Transmission Control Module (TCM), monitors signals from various sensors and solenoids involved in shifting gears. When these signals are out of expected ranges or irregular, the system flags this as a shift error.

This code is frequently triggered when the transmission fails to shift properly, shifts are delayed, or there are unexpected shifts. Typically, it appears when there’s a malfunction within the transmission solenoid circuits, wiring faults, or mechanical issues impeding proper gear engagement.

Severity and risks of trouble code P0780

The P0780 trouble code presents a **moderate to high level of concern** depending on the severity of the symptoms. The most significant risk is potential **damage to the transmission** due to improper shifting or prolonged operation in an abnormal state. Furthermore, the vehicle’s drivability could be affected, making driving less smooth or even unsafe if the transmission behaves unpredictably.

**Can you drive with this code?** The answer is: **Limited**. While in many cases the vehicle can still be driven temporarily, persistent shifting problems may lead to further damage or complete transmission failure if not addressed promptly. Therefore, it is **highly recommended** to diagnose and repair this fault as soon as possible.

Symptoms of trouble code P0780

When P0780 is stored, several symptoms may manifest, often warning of transmission issues. While not all symptoms appear simultaneously, common indicators include:

  • Erratic gear shifts: Hesitation, slipping, or unexpected gear changes
  • Transmission warning light: Illuminates on the dashboard
  • Reduced driveability: Decreased acceleration or responsiveness
  • Unusual transmission noise: Clunking, whining, or buzzing sounds during shifts
  • Transmission stuck in a limited mode: For example, limp mode, with reduced speeds and gear options
  • Delayed shifting or failure to shift

Most likely causes of trouble code P0780

Many factors can lead to the P0780 code. Typically, they relate to issues in the transmission control system involving electrical or mechanical components. Here are the **most common causes**, ranked from most to least likely:

  1. Faulty transmission solenoid or solenoid pack: These components control hydraulic pressure and gear engagement
  2. Wiring or connector issues: Loose, damaged, or corroded electrical connections leading to signal interruptions
  3. Transmission fluid problems: Low, dirty, or contaminated fluid affecting hydraulic functions
  4. Mechanical transmission faults: Internal damage, worn components, or broken gears
  5. Faulty Transmission Control Module (TCM): Electronic control unit malfunction or software glitch
  6. Clogged or malfunctioning transmission filter

How to diagnose trouble code P0780

Diagnosing P0780 should be approached systematically, combining visual inspections with live data analysis. Consider the following generic diagnostic steps:

  1. Visual inspection: Check transmission fluid level and condition; look for disconnected or corroded wiring connectors
  2. Scan for additional codes: Identify if related transmission or sensor codes are present
  3. Review live data stream: Use a diagnostic scanner to observe transmission shift solenoid signals and pressure data
  4. Perform electrical tests: Check continuity of wiring circuits; test transmission solenoids directly if accessible
  5. Inspect transmission fluid: Ensure proper level, quality, and absence of debris
  6. Test transmission components: In some cases, a professional may perform pressure tests, solenoid activation, or internal mechanical inspection

Possible repairs for trouble code P0780

Based on the diagnosed cause, repairs can range from simple to complex. Here are potential solutions, categorized and linked logically to common causes:

  • Replace faulty transmission solenoids: Usually a professional task due to complexity
  • Repair or replace wiring and connectors: A straightforward repair that involves cleaning or replacing damaged wiring
  • Change transmission fluid and filter: Basic maintenance procedure performed by most technicians
  • Address mechanical transmission issues: Includes internal repairs, which require specialised transmission rebuild or replacement
  • Reprogram or replace the TCM: Software updates or hardware replacement by a qualified technician

Vehicles commonly associated with trouble code P0780 in Europe

While P0780 can occur in various vehicles, certain makes and models are more frequently involved, especially those with known transmission control system issues. In Europe, common affected brands include:

Ford: Focus, Mondeo, Fiesta

Volkswagen Group: Golf, Passat, Tiguan

BMW: 1 Series, 3 Series, X Series

Hyundai/Kia: Elantra, Cerato, Sportage

Peugeot/Citroën: 208, 308, C3

Frequent mistakes with trouble code P0780

Diagnosing and repairing P0780 can sometimes lead to avoidable mistakes that extend repair time or worsen the issue. Common errors include:

  • Overlooking wiring and electrical connections: Ignoring wiring issues that trigger false positives
  • Misdiagnosing fluid problems as electrical faults: Failing to check fluid levels and quality
  • Replacing components without confirming cause: Swapping solenoids or TCM without proper testing
  • Ignoring related codes: Focusing solely on P0780 and missing concurrent issues
  • Using unverified software or tools: Risk of doing unnecessary repairs or incorrect diagnoses

FAQ — trouble code P0780

Can this code disappear on its own? Yes, sometimes a temporary glitch or sensor interference can clear the code after a reset. However, persistent issues usually return unless properly repaired.

Can I keep driving? It depends on the severity. If the transmission is slipping or shifting erratically, continued driving may cause further damage. Most often, limited driving is recommended until diagnosis and repair are completed.

Why does the code return after clearing? Because the root cause—such as a faulty solenoid, wiring problem, or internal mechanical fault—remains unaddressed, the code is likely to recur. Proper diagnosis and fixing the underlying issue are essential for permanent resolution.

Retour en haut